Cherry Crumble

This delectable Cherry Crumble uses only 5 ingredients. It's a cross between a Cherry Crisp and a Cherry Cobbler. This mouthwatering dessert will cure any sweet tooth craving you have. Prep Time 20 minutes
Cook Time 1 hour
Total Time 1 hour 20 minutes
Course Dessert
Cuisine American
Servings 15
Calories 198 kcal

Ingredients
  

  • 4-5 cups Northwest Cherry Growers cherries pitted and halved
  • 3/4 cup granulated sugar
  • 2-4 tbsp. water (I used 2)
  • 1 cup brown sugar packed
  • 1 cup UNBLEACHED all-purpose flour (bleached flour toughens baked goods)
  • 1/2 cup unsalted butter cold (1 stick)

Instructions
 

  • Combine cherries with granulated sugar and water.
  • Spread into a greased 8x12” glass baking dish.
  • Combine brown sugar and flour.
  • Cut butter into flour mixture with finger tips or pastry blender until it crumbles.
  • Pour crumble mixture over top of cherries.
  • Bake at 300 degrees for about an hour or until cherries are done.
